Product Overview

Category

TC4432EJA belongs to the category of integrated circuits (ICs).

Use

The TC4432EJA is commonly used as a high-speed MOSFET driver. It is designed to provide efficient switching control for power MOSFETs in various applications.

Characteristics

  • High-speed switching capability
  • Low input/output capacitance
  • Wide operating voltage range
  • High output current capability
  • Low power consumption

Package

The TC4432EJA is available in a small outline package (SOP) with 8 pins.

Essence

The essence of TC4432EJA lies in its ability to drive power MOSFETs efficiently and reliably, enabling precise control over switching operations.

Packaging/Quantity

The TC4432EJA is typically packaged in reels or tubes, with each reel or tube containing a specific quantity of ICs. The exact packaging and quantity may vary depending on the supplier.

Specifications

  • Supply Voltage: 4.5V to 18V
  • Output Current: 1.5A
  • Input Threshold Voltage: 0.8V
  • Rise/Fall Time: 15ns
  • Operating Temperature Range: -40°C to +125°C

Working Principles

The TC4432EJA operates by receiving control signals at the input pin (IN) and generating corresponding output signals at the high-side (HO) and low-side (LO) outputs. These output signals drive the gate of the power MOSFET, controlling its switching behavior. The bootstrap supply voltage (VS) and bootstrap capacitor voltage (VB) inputs are used to generate the necessary gate drive voltages.
